The Effects of Intake Plenum Volume on the Performance of a Small Naturally Aspirated Restricted Engine

Abstract: Intake tuning is a widely recognized method for optimizing the performance of a naturally aspirated engine for motorsports applications. Wave resonance and Helmholtz theories are useful for predicting the impact of intake runner length on engine performance. However, there is very little information in the literature regarding the effects of intake plenum volume.
